Popis: Measurements have been made of afterpulses induced by light from a blue LED in EMI 9823B, Hamamatsu R1250, Mullard XP2041 and RCA 8854 fast linear-focussed photomultiplier tubes. The RCA and Hamamatsu tubes were found to produce significantly fewer afterpulses than the EMI and Mullard tubes. More detailed measurements of the Hamamatsu R1250 indicated that the total number of afterpulses is proportional to the magnitude of the initial flash and consists of two components. The first component is independent of the wavelength of the initial light flash, arises from ionization of residual gas in the phototube and can be effectively suppressed by gating the photomultiplier. The second component is wavelength-dependent, dominates the first component at short wavelengths, and cannot be significantly reduced by gating. It is possibly due to fluorescence of the phototube glass envelope or excitation of a metastable state of the photocathode. Similar components were found to contribute to afterpulsing in the RCA 8854 PMT.
